[QUOTE="Barrysghost, post: 419608, member: 5376"] Suh has never been named a "locker room cancer". The rest of the team actually loves the guy, and only Bears and Packers fans seem to cry "DIRTY!!!" all the time. This is the guys SECOND SEASON. He just came off of a pro-bowl rookie year where he was not called dirty at all. Oh, and he didn't "stomp his head into the ground", he wasn't even looking at the guy when he stomped. You guys are making a mountain out of a molehill, and don't seem to want to acknowledge his 2 game suspension and fine as punishment. Most of this guy's frustration comes from the fact that he is constantly double and triple blocked. He had a lot of 1 on 1 his first season, and dominated. He expected to have another stellar year, but it hasn't happened due to the respect he's already being given in his SECOND SEASON. So, he's frustrated. On top of that (and don't try to deny it happens) guys talk smack on the field. Your team does it, my team does it, every team does it. Add to that: apparently this guy (Smith?) was untying Suh's shoes in every pile up (lol), and that last time Suh got really pissed. When he had the guys helmet, grinding it into the turf, you can see he's saying something to him. According to Suh, it was something along the lines of "quit untying my f***king shoes!!!" Then, when trying to leave the situation, he thought the dude was grabbing at his foot and did a shake-off type stomp. I guess where I'm going with this: There have been way uglier and dirtier characters in the NFL than Suh. Even when the guy has no penalties or altercations in a game, he still gets called dirty. If you guys hate Suh, you must REALLY hate: Shaun Smith (the genital grabber), Chuck Cecil (blackballed by NFL), Bill Romanowski (spitting in faces), and Butkus (who actually said "I try to injure people"). This is a rough sport, and Suh plays it rough. A victim of his own talent, he is double and triple blocked and it frustrates him. I AGREE, he needs to cool down, but like I've said before: ONLY his SECOND SEASON. He has time to tone it back, and at least he isn't grabbing nutsacks or spitting in faces. [/QUOTE]
